Mar 9, 2012 · What Are Micro Emini Futures? The Micro Emini futures contract is the same as the “regular” S&P 500 Emini contract in every respect, except it is 1/10th the size. That is, each 1 point move in the S&P 500 index is worth $5 per Micro Emini contract, compared to $50 for the Emini (ES). And the margin to trade a Micro Emini contract is also 1 ... Here are the E-mini S&P 500 futures contract specifications. E-mini S&P 500 futures contract specifications. 0.25, worth $12.50 per contract. E-mini S&P 500 futures trade on the CME Globex ® trading platform, from 6:00 p.m. U.S. ET all the way until 5:00 p.m. U.S. ET the following afternoon. E-mini S&P 500 futures trade on a quarterly cycle.CME created micro contracts to address investor demand for smaller versions of ES and other stock indexes. According to CME, “the notional value of the E-mini S&P 500 futures contract has increased from $47K on the date that it launched to $125K on December 31, 2018. The amount of capital needed to access the futures market has …If the S&P 500 Index is trading at 2750, the notional value of one Micro E-mini S&P 500 futures contract is $13,750. Similar to the E-mini, the tick increments of the Micro E-mini S&P 500 are quoted in a quarter of one point, a one tick move in the Micro E-mini S&P 500 equates to $1.25. A one-point move, which is four ticks, is worth $5.Investors who want to engage in futures trading must have an account with a registered commodity futures broker. CME Micro E-mini Futures vs. Exchange-Traded Funds. Active traders have many ways to engage the world’s equities markets. Among the most popular are exchange-traded funds (ETFs) and futures. As of May 2019, CME Micro E-mini futures became the latest equities futures product to enter the fray. The Functionality of ETFs

Sep 15, 2021 · Micro E-mini Futures are basically smaller versions of the CME Group's popular E-mini stock index futures contracts, checking in at just 1/10th the size. The CME Group created them because the classic E-minis had become too expensive for many traders, effectively shutting them out of the liquid futures market. Watch the videos below to preview the course, or if you're already a client, go ahead and enroll in the full course .The “multiplier” used to determine the notional value for Micro E-mini S&Ps, at $5, is also one-tenth the size of the E-mini S&P contract. If the S&P 500 index is trading at 3,000, one Micro E-mini S&P 500 contract would be 3,000 times the $5 multiplier for a notional value of $15,000. The Micro E-mini Nasdaq-100 futures contract is $2 x the Nasdaq-100 Index and has a minimum tick of 0.25 index points. One contract of Dow Jones E-mini futures (MYM) settles for $0.50 times the current value of the Dow Jones Index. The minimum price fluctuation is 1.00 index point, which is equal to $0.50 per contract.
